Hmm: Why aliens will be nice -
- They don't need anything we need
-- either their economy is different from ours due to advancement or radically different environment or
-- a non-zero-sum situation exists where there is way more than enough universe to go around
- They might be able to gain from trade
-- This scenario is plausible even if they can't reach us at all due to interstellar distances. We could trade information far easier than matter.
Hmm - examples:
Suppose you have a sentient race of AIs who view the mind in general terms, abstracted from the particular hardware that sustains it. Their needs might be something along the lines of building and powering vast computer arrays to sustain more AI's, or more computing resources for the existing AI programs. From their perspective, earthlike planets might look as nasty as Venus looks to us - why bother building on a planet with shifting unpredictable fluid dynamic forces within a corrosive atmosphere, being constantly blasted by water? They might be looking for places with relatively static dead environments, ready access to energy and a heat sink. The terminator of mercury would be prime real-estate! Panels on one side, radiators on the other, heavy elements available.
Furthermore, they might want to enlist our aid in colonization rather than sending an invasion fleet. They could send us plans to build their host computers and recieving arrays. Then they wouldn't have to build starships at all - they would just send themselves along with their other transmissions, help us build their spacecraft, and head off for a "gentler" climate.
